BF66 FTJ is a 2016 Vauxhall Insignia in White with a 1,364c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2016 Vauxhall Insignia models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.0% with a typical mileage of 64,248 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Insignia f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 45,793 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BF66 FTJ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Insignia typ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 10 years old, this Vauxhall Insignia is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
